传奇私服SQL:开启你的传奇之旅,重塑游戏世界

在现代游戏世界中,私服(私人服务器)已经成为了玩家们探索和重塑游戏世界的重要方式。而在这些私服中,SQL(结构化查询语言)扮演着不可或缺的角色。
无论是为了调整游戏数据、优化游戏体验,还是为了实现一些独特的游戏功能,SQL都是必不可少的工具。本部分将详细介绍传奇私服SQL的基础知识,并分享一些基础但实用的SQL技巧。
什么是传奇私服SQL?传奇私服SQL是指在传奇游戏私服中使用结构化查询语言进行数据库操作的过程。
SQL是一种标准的数据库操作语言,用于管理和操作关系型数据库。在传奇私服中,SQL主要用于修改游戏中的数据,包括但不限于角色信息、道具、任务、奖励等等。
通过掌握SQL,玩家可以对游戏数据进行高效的管理和定制,从而创造出更加丰富和多样的游戏体验。SQL的基础语法 SELECT:用于查询数据库中的数据SELECT*FROMcharactersWHERElevel>50; 这条语句将查询所有等级大于50的角色信息。
INSERT:用于向数据库中添加新数据INSERTINTOitems(name,type,level_required)VALUES('传说之剑','武器',70); 这条语句将向数据库中插入一条新的武器数据。UPDATE:用于修改数据库中的现有数据UPDATEcharactersSETlevel=level+1WHEREid=12345; 这条语句将升级ID为12345的角色的等级。
DELETE:用于删除数据库中的数据DELETEFROMcharactersWHEREid=12345; 这条语句将删除ID为12345的角色信息。常见的SQL操作 角色数据管理 角色数据是私服中最核心的数据之一,通过SQL,你可以轻松管理和调整角色的各项属性。
查询角色信息 SELECT*FROMcharactersWHEREname='勇士'; 这条语句可以查询名字为“勇士”的角色信息。增加角色 INSERTINTOcharacters(name,level,hp,strength)VALUES('弓箭手',30,500,80); 这条语句可以向数据库中添加一名新的弓箭手角色。
升级角色 UPDATEcharactersSETlevel=level+1WHEREname='勇士'; 这条语句可以将名字为“勇士”的角色升级一级。道具管理 道具管理是游戏中另一项重要的任务,通过SQL,你可以方便地添加、修改和删除道具。
查询道具信息 SELECT*FROMitemsWHEREtype='武器'; 这条语句可以查询所有武器类道具的信息。添加新道具 INSERTINTOitems(name,type,level_required)VALUES('神秘卷轴','卷轴',0); 这条语句可以向数据库中添加一条新的神秘卷轴道具。
删除道具 DELETEFROMitemsWHEREname='神秘卷轴'; 这条语句可以删除名字为“神秘卷轴”的道具。安全和备份 在操作游戏数据库时,安全和备份是必须考虑的问题。
任何一次错误的操作都可能导致不可恢复的数据损失,因此,在进行任何SQL操作之前,务必先备份数据库。备份数据库 备份数据库的最简单方法是将数据库文件复制到安全的位置。
不同的数据库管理系统可能有不同的备份方法,但基本思路都是一样的。恢复数据库 在发生数据丢失或损坏时,你可以通过恢复备份的数据库文件来恢复数据。
这一步非常重要,因此务必定期进行备份。高级技巧分享 对于那些已经掌握了基础SQL操作的玩家,本部分将分享一些高级技巧,帮助你在传奇私服中创造出更加独特和有趣的游戏体验。
数据分析 通过SQL,你可以对游戏中的数据进行详细的分析,这不仅能帮助你更好地理解游戏机制,还能为你提供新的游戏玩法和策略。查询最高等级角色 SELECTname,levelFROMcharactersORDERBYlevelDESCLIMIT1; 这条语句可以查询最高等级的角色。
查询最常用道具 SELECTname,COUNT(*)ascountFROMinventoryGROUPBYnameORDERBYcountDESCLIMIT1; 这条语句可以查询最常用的道具。数据增强 通过SQL,你可以对游戏数据进行增强,使游戏更加有趣和挑战。
增加角色属性 UPDATEcharactersSETstrength=strength+10WHEREname='勇士'; 这条语句可以增加名字为“勇士”的角色的力量值。增加道具属性 UPDATEitemsSETdamage=damage+10WHEREname='传说之剑'; 这条语句可以增加“传说之剑”的攻击力。
自定义事件 通过SQL,你可以创建一些自定义的游戏事件,增加游戏的趣味性。添加新任务 INSERTINTOquests(name,description,reward)VALUES('神秘宝藏','寻找隐藏的宝藏','1000金币'); 这条语句可以添加一个新的任务。
触发事件 UPDATEeventsSETstatus='active'WHEREname='神秘###创新与实现:传奇私服SQL的实际应用在传奇私服中,SQL的应用不仅仅局限于数据的查询、插入、更新和删除,更重要的是通过这些基本操作,你可以创新和实现一些独特的游戏功能,从而为玩家带来全新的游戏体验。本部分将详细介绍一些实际应用,帮助你充分发挥SQL的潜力。
####自定义奖励系统在传奇私服中,通过SQL,你可以创建一个自定义的奖励系统,为玩家提供更多的激励和挑战。创建奖励表 sqlCREATETABLErewards(idINTAUTOINCREMENTPRIMARYKEY,nameVARCHAR(50),descriptionTEXT,rewardtypeVARCHAR(50),valueINT); 这条语句创建了一个奖励表,用于存储各种奖励信息。
插入奖励数据 sqlINSERTINTOrewards(name,description,reward_type,value)VALUES('神秘宝箱','完成特殊任务获得','装备',5000),('经验增益卷轴','完成每日任务获得','经验',1000); 这条语句向奖励表中插入了两条奖励数据。查询奖励 sqlSELECT*FROMrewardsWHEREreward_type='装备'; 这条语句可以查询所有装备类奖励。
####动态任务生成通过SQL,你可以实现动态任务生成,使游戏更加丰富多彩。创建任务表 sqlCREATETABLEquests(idINTAUTO_INCREMENTPRIMARYKEY,nameVARCHAR(50),descriptionTEXT,statusVARCHAR(20),rewardINT); 这条语句创建了一个任务表,用于存储各种任务信息。
插入任务数据 sqlINSERTINTOquests(name,description,status,reward)VALUES('护送商队','保护商队安全通过','active',500); 这条语句向任务表中插入了一条新的任务数据。查询任务 sqlSELECT*FROMquestsWHEREstatus='active'; 这条语句可以查询所有活跃状态的任务。
####NPC对话系统通过SQL,你可以为游戏中的NPC添加对话系统,使游戏更加生动和有趣。创建对话表 sqlCREATETABLEnpcdialogues(idINTAUTOINCREMENTPRIMARYKEY,npcidINT,dialoguetextTEXT,nextdialogueINT,FOREIGNKEY(npcid)REFERENCESnpcs(id)); 这条语句创建了一个对话表,用于存储NPC的对话内容。
插入对话数据 sqlINSERTINTOnpcdialogues(npcid,dialoguetext,nextdialogue)VALUES(1,'你好,我是村长,有什么需要帮助的吗?',2),(2,'你需要完成一些任务来帮助村庄',NULL); 这条语句向对话表中插入了NPC对话数据。
查询对话 sqlSELECTdialoguetextFROMnpcdialoguesWHEREnpcid=1ANDnextdialogueISNULL; 这条语句可以查询NPCID为1的最终对话。####数据可视化通过SQL,你可以对游戏中的数据进行可视化,帮助你更好地理解和管理游戏数据。
查询最高等级角色 sqlSELECTname,levelFROMcharactersORDERBYlevelDESCLIMIT1; 这条语句可以查询最高等级的角色。查询最常用道具 sqlSELECTname,COUNT(*)ascountFROMinventoryGROUPBYnameORDERBYcountDESCLIMIT1;```这条语句可以查询最常用的道具。
实践与分享 在实际应用中,你可能会遇到一些问题或挑战。在这种情况下,分享和交流非常重要。
可以加入一些游戏社区,与其他玩家分享你的经验和技巧,这不仅能帮助你解决问题,还能让你学到更多新的知识。社区和论坛 加入一些游戏社区和论坛,与其他玩家交流和分享。
这些平台通常有丰富的资源和经验分享,可以帮助你快速解决问题。博客和视频 如果你有一定的技术水平,可以写博客或制作视频,分享你在传奇私服SQL中的经验和技巧。
这不仅能帮助你提升自己,还能帮助更多的玩家。在传奇私服中,SQL是一个强大的工具,可以让你对游戏数据进行高效的管理和定制。
通过掌握SQL的基础知识和实际应用,你可以创新和实现一些独特的游戏功能,为玩家带来全新的游戏体验。无论你是新手还是资深玩家,希望本文能够为你提供一些有用的信息和灵感,让你在传奇私服中获得更多的乐趣和成就。
网友评论
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。

玩了几小时,根本停不下来
别的不管,好看就完事了
游戏不错,但定价偏高
期待值拉满,就等正式版
先观望一波,看口碑再入手
适合真爱粉,路人谨慎入手